Brackenthwaite is a hamlet standing alone in the lanes some three miles south-east of the town of Wigton in Cumberland.
Name
The name is recorded as Bracanethuaite in the 12th Century: it is believed to be from the Old Norse brakni meaning 'bush' and þveit, a common Norse village suffix.
There is an identically named village elsewhere in the county: Brackenthwaite that is south of here and about six miles south of Cockermouth.)
